" Slice ceramic utility replacement blades are designed to work
exclusively with Slice handles (sold separately) to optimize
safety and function. Compatible only with #10550 Smarty Manual
Cutter #10554 Smarty Auto Cutter #10558 Smarty Smart Retractable
Cutter. For other Slice Boxcutters (10400/10503) or Pen cutters
(10512/10513) or Craft Cutters (10514) please utilize Slice 10404
(Rounded Tip) or 10408 (Pointed Tip) blades. Both blade options
feature dual sided edges. 1.3 mm thick for strength and
durability. Patented blade with proprietary sharpening creates a
safer blade. Double sided equivalent of up to 20 single-edge
blades. Use the pointed blade tips (10528) for cutting thinner
items like paper. On the Mohs hardness scale, Metal blades are
rated 5.5 vs. Ceramic blades at 8.2, second only to diamonds.
Harder edges maintain sharpness longer, cut better, and require
replacement far less frequently. In fact, depending on use, you
can go weeks or months without having to replace a single ceramic
blade. They also last up to 10x longer! Saving Money Just Makes

Slice Handle: Smart Retracting Blade stays hidden by default.
Press slider button to release blade up to 1”. User must hold
slider button while cutting, as the smart blade will retract as
the user pulls away from cutting material. Preventing injuries
when applying excessive force at the end of a cut.
Slice Handle: 5 Position Manual Blade Blade stays where
positioned. Press the slider button to choose from one of five
blade positions – customizing the blade length for each job. (Up
to 1”). After cutting, User must toggle slider button to hide
blade.
Slice Handle: Auto-Retracting Blade stays hidden by default.
Press slider button to release blade up to 1". User must hold
slider button while cutting - Upon releasing button, the blade
will retract safely. Ideal for Safety Environments.
